SuperTiling performance
Here's a completely loony test that I just had to try. I turned off Catalyst A.I., effectively forcing the CrossFire cards into SuperTiling mode, to see how they would perform.
The SuperTiling CrossFire rig is really pokey in 3DMark05's three game tests, even slower than a single card. This performance is pretty well consistent with what we saw in the F.E.A.R. demo and Guild Wars, where turning on CrossFire was a net performance loss. These results can't be encouraging for those pinning their hopes on CrossFire "just working" in any 3D game.
The three synthetic pixel-pushing tests above confirm that SuperTiling is indeed working correctly; the basic fill rate and pixel shading power of the two Radeon X850 XT cards is evident.
SuperTiling doesn't help vertex processing performance, just as expected. The SuperTiling setup performs like a single card in the vertex shader tests. The CrossFire rig must normally run in AFR mode in 3DMark05.
